Donegal Gardaí seize car from uninsured speeding learner driver

written by Staff Writer October 21, 2024
FacebookTweetLinkedInPrint

Gardaí in Donegal town detected a car travelling at 134 KPH per hour in a 100 KPH speed zone on the N15 in the early hours of this morning. 

They subsequently discovered the driver was an unaccompanied learner who had no insurance. The NCT on the vehicle had also expired in excess of a year and the front tyres were excessively worn. The vehicle was seized.

“Never take dangerous risks on the roads. Slow down,” a garda spokesperson said.

“If you are not insured to drive, stay off the road. Never take to the road before ensuring that your vehicle is in a roadworthy condition.”
